Output 8066187334e1d81ce1ae7887cccee8b5058c320f8256d2605df23428c27ef797:1

value
26978
script pubkey
OP_0 OP_PUSHBYTES_20 02686ebf44b460f8d524e9b3e81b443e70d811c3
address
bc1qqf5xa06yk3s034fyaxe7sx6y8ecdsywr2c2qkl
transaction
8066187334e1d81ce1ae7887cccee8b5058c320f8256d2605df23428c27ef797
confirmations
206496
spent
true